#273791 hex color
In a RGB color space, hex #273791 is composed of 15.3% red, 21.6% green and 56.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 73.1% cyan, 62.1% magenta, 0% yellow and 43.1% black. It has a hue angle of 230.9 degrees, a saturation of 57.6% and a lightness of 36.1%. #273791 color hex could be obtained by blending #4e6eff with #000023. Closest websafe color is: #333399.

● #273791 color description : Dark blue.
The hexadecimal color #273791 has RGB values of R:39, G:55, B:145 and CMYK values of C:0.73, M:0.62, Y:0, K:0.43. Its decimal value is 2570129.
